ACCESS数据库人员信息管理系统开发

需积分: 5 0 下载量 9 浏览量 更新于2024-11-18 收藏 4MB RAR 举报
资源摘要信息:"本资源包名为'students management.rar',主要面向需要进行学生信息管理系统的开发者。其中包含的核心知识点涵盖了Microsoft Access数据库的操作,C语言编程,以及Visual Studio 2012开发环境的使用。通过这个资源包,用户可以学习如何使用这些工具和技术来创建一个可以增加、删除人员信息并具备登录功能的学生管理系统。" 知识点一:Microsoft Access数据库基础 1. Access数据库结构:了解Access数据库是由表、查询、表单、报表、宏和模块组成的,每个组件的作用与基本操作。 2. 数据表设计:学习如何在Access中创建和设计表,设置主键,索引,以及字段类型和属性,以确保数据的准确性和一致性。 3. 数据操作:掌握在Access中使用SQL语句进行数据的增加、删除和更新操作,即增删改查(CRUD)。 知识点二:C语言编程基础 1. C语言语法:掌握C语言的基本语法结构,包括变量、运算符、控制语句和函数等。 2. 文件操作:学习使用C语言进行文件读写操作,以便实现对数据库文件的访问和管理。 3. 数据结构:了解和使用链表、数组等数据结构来存储人员信息,为管理操作提供基础。 知识点三:Visual Studio 2012开发环境 1. VS2012界面和工具:熟悉Visual Studio 2012的用户界面布局、项目管理器、解决方案资源管理器等。 2. 项目配置和构建:了解如何在VS2012中配置项目,包括设置编译选项、引用外部库和构建调试程序。 3. 调试与测试:掌握使用Visual Studio 2012进行代码调试和测试,确保程序运行的稳定性和正确性。 知识点四:学生信息管理系统功能实现 1. 登录功能:学习如何实现用户身份验证,通过用户名和密码实现登录控制,保证系统的安全性。 2. 人员信息管理:掌握如何在系统中添加、更新、删除和查询学生信息,利用Access数据库与C语言程序交互,实现信息的持久化存储。 3. 用户界面设计:使用Visual Studio 2012开发出友好且直观的用户界面,为用户提供良好的交互体验。 知识点五:系统测试与部署 1. 单元测试:通过编写测试用例,对每个模块的功能进行单元测试,确保代码质量。 2. 集成测试:测试各个模块组合在一起后的整体运行情况,确保各个模块协同工作无误。 3. 部署:了解如何将开发完成的系统部署到目标环境,包括用户计算机或服务器上。 知识点六:项目实践注意事项 1. 数据备份与恢复:在进行数据库操作前做好数据备份,以防数据丢失,同时学会数据恢复操作。 2. 异常处理:在操作数据库时可能出现各种异常,掌握C语言中的异常处理机制,确保程序的健壮性。 3. 安全性:在设计系统时考虑安全性,如防止SQL注入、密码加密存储等,提高系统的安全性。 以上就是从标题、描述和标签中提取的知识点。通过对这些知识点的学习和实践,开发者可以掌握创建一个简单学生信息管理系统的基本技能。